Responsibilities include:

  • Deliver one-to-one support for students with ASD and complex needs, following specific instructions within Education, Health and Care Plans (EHCPs).
  • Assist students with daily personal care requirements, including feeding, toileting, and mobility support.
  • Use de-escalation techniques to manage challenging behaviour and maintain a calm classroom environment.
  • Support the class teacher by preparing sensory resources and adapted learning materials.
  • Monitor the physical well-being of students with complex medical needs and report any changes to the school nursing team.
  • Help students transition between lessons and therapy sessions throughout the school day.

Requirements:

  • Minimum of 6 months UK experience supporting children or young people with SEN, specifically Complex Needs and SEMH.
  • Experience working within a secondary school or high school environment is highly desirable.
  • Solid understanding of safeguarding procedures and the ability to recognise and report concerns immediately.
  • Enhanced Children and Adults DBS on the update service (or willingness to process a new application).
